Proper "bag technique" is an important part of infection control in home healthcare. During this course, learners will dive deep into infection control tactics to help prevent the spread of disease when visiting patients in their home, including how to effectively prevent contamination of the healthcare bag and other equipment and how proper bag technique helps protect patients, family members, and healthcare workers from the spread of infection.

Objectives:
1) Discuss the importance of infection control in home health through proper bag technique
2) Detail the application of proper bag technique to stop the transmission of infection
